Good to Know
This belt fits headers with serial numbers 785000 and higher – if your header is older than that, you’ll need the 301-D35348 version instead. When replacing side belts, it’s smart to check the condition of your drive pulleys and tensioners at the same time to get the most life out of your new belts.
